CNC MACHINING AND POWER MILL (MILLING) COURSE
CNC Machining is a mix between manufacturing knowledge and CAM software. So, in this course, you will it in one package. You will learn about machines, materials, machining parameters, and CAM software.
Duration:
Total 40 Hours (8 Lecture)
2 Lectures per week
5 Hours Per Lecture
Who Should attend?
CADCAM Engineers
CNC Programmers
Manufacturers
Industrial designer
Pre-Requirements
Manufacturing Background
Level
Advanced level
Content
Introduction to machining and Materials
CNC Tools
2.5 Axis and 3 Axis Machining
PowerMill interface Rough Strategies
Finishing Strategies
Toolpath verification and editing
Required tools
Computer with PowerMill installed
